STEM Expo Returns to µÚÒ»³Ô¹ÏÍø in 2026
March 25, 2026
The STEM Expo returned to µÚÒ»³Ô¹ÏÍønical Community College on March 18 after a one-year break. Held at three µÚÒ»³Ô¹ÏÍø campuses statewide, the event welcomed middle and high school students interested in STEM careers. Students had the chance to deepen their understanding of STEM concepts, learn about Delaware STEM CTE Pathways, and discover potential future careers at µÚÒ»³Ô¹ÏÍø.
Highlights of the event included interactive activities created by µÚÒ»³Ô¹ÏÍø students and hands-on initiatives led by faculty, showcasing the depth and real-world value of the College’s STEM programs. Middle and high school students, along with parents, educators, and local employers, were invited to attend and participate.
Distributed across all four campuses, 75 exhibits showcased µÚÒ»³Ô¹ÏÍø's workforce and instructional programs. More than 150 volunteers, including students, faculty, and staff from the College, attended to support the event, which was made possible by a National Science Foundation EPSCoR Grant and the State of Delaware. Additional funding was provided by AstraZeneca.
